Invisalign Is Only for Minor Misalignments



Unlike typical idea, Invisalign isn't restricted to remedying minor imbalances - it can successfully address more complex oral problems too. Many people assume that Invisalign is just ideal for small modifications, however the reality is that it can deal with a wide range of orthodontic troubles.

Whether you have chock-full teeth, spaces, overbites, underbites, or crossbites, Invisalign can be a viable alternative for you.

Invisalign utilizes advanced modern technology to produce customized aligners that slowly move your teeth into the preferred position. These aligners are made to apply the right amount of stress to relocate your teeth successfully. Additionally, Invisalign therapy is checked by your dental practitioner to make certain that your teeth are relocating appropriately throughout the procedure.

Invisalign Treatment Takes As Well Long



Issues concerning the duration of Invisalign treatment are commonly based upon misunderstandings. Many people think that traditional braces are much faster than Invisalign, but this isn't always the instance. Invisalign treatment size varies depending on specific demands, normally ranging from 6 to 18 months.

In some cases, Invisalign can achieve outcomes much faster than traditional braces as a result of its innovative innovation and personalized treatment strategies. The period of your Invisalign therapy is affected by different aspects such as the intricacy of your instance, your commitment to putting on the aligners as prescribed, and your body's response to the treatment.

Regularly changing your aligners as instructed by your orthodontist is vital for the success and efficiency of the therapy procedure.
